    The first SIR-C/X-SAR mission was flown in April 1994. Part of the acquired SAR data have been downlinked, analyzed and processed to precision images at the German Processing and Archiving Facility (PAF) at DLR. This paper summarizes the first analysis results of raw data and image quality. It is shown that already during the mission using preliminary orbit information the product quality requirements have been surpassed.
